Mercedes-benz Eqc 400 edition 1886 4matic
Based on 102 Mercedes-benz Eqc 400 edition 1886 4matic vehicles and 466 completed MOT tests, the Mercedes-benz Eqc 400 edition 1886 4matic has an overall 90% pass rate, with an average recorded mileage of 48,603 miles.

Most common Mercedes-benz Eqc 400 edition 1886 4matic MOT faults
These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Mercedes-benz Eqc 400 edition 1886 4matic MOT tests:
- Nearside Front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(32 times)
- Offside Front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(29 times)
- Nearside Rear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(19 times)
- Offside Rear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(17 times)
- Nearside Front Outer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(9 times)
- Nearside Front Lower Suspension arm ball joint has slight play (5.3.4 (a) (i)) (9 times)
- Nearside Rear Inner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(7 times)
- Offside Front Outer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(7 times)
- Offside Rear Inner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ge (5.2.3 (e)) (7 times)
- Offside Front Lower Suspension arm ball joint has slight play (5.3.4 (a) (i)) (7 times)
- Nearside Front Suspension arm ball joint has slight play (5.3.4 (a) (i)) (7 times)
- Nearside Front Tyre slightly damaged/cracking or perishing (5.2.3 (d) (ii)) (6 times)
- Offside Front Lower Suspension arm ball joint excessively worn (5.3.4 (a) (i)) (6 times)
- Nearside Rear Tyre slightly damaged/cracking or perishing (5.2.3 (d) (ii)) (6 times)
- Nearside Front Tyre has a cut in excess of the requirements deep enough to reach the ply or cords (5.2.3 (d) (i)) (5 times)
